About Moises Auron, MD

Moises Auron, MD, FAAP, FACP, SFHM is a Staff Physician at both the Department of Hospital Medicine and the Department of Pediatric Hospital Medicine at the Cleveland Clinic. He is dual board-certified in Internal Medicine and Pediatrics, as well as in Pediatric Hospital Medicine. Dr. Auron is a Professor of Medicine and Pediatrics at the Cleveland Clinic Lerner College of Medicine of Case Western Reserve University (CWRU) and is a Master Teacher of the CWRU School of Medicine Academy of Scholar Educators. He is a core faculty at the Pediatric Hospital Medicine fellowship program. Former core faculty at the Internal Medicine residency program. He is the Quality Improvement and Patient Safety Officer of the Department of Hospital Medicine, Cleveland Clinic Main campus, and the Medical Director of Blood Management, Cleveland Clinic which also covers intraoperative cell saver utilization. Dr. Auron is also an Advanced Peer Coach and Mentor at the Cleveland Clinic Center for Executive Coaching and Mentoring.

He has a special interest in hospital and perioperative medicine, quality and patient safety with emphasis in blood management and publicly reported healthcare measures. He is also passionate about coaching and mentoring.

In Pediatrics, his area of interest includes hospital and perioperative medicine as well as pediatric obesity, eating disorders, and transition to adulthood of patients with complex chronic diseases of childhood.
